Urbanscapes 2012: Updates!

by Lainey
August 17, 2012
Share on FacebookShare on Whatsapp

This year’s grand slam Malaysian creative arts festival is slated to happen on 24th and 25th November 2012. Did you know? Sigur Rós is going to be headlining and our homegrown (now international) singer-songwriter Yuna will be taking the stage the day before.

But the list of acts have grown since the initial Urbanscapes 2012 announcement. So here’s a glance at what else and more importantly, who else you can expect to see this year:

The Impatient Sisters: Musical sisters that bring sweet folk harmonies to the stage. Already making waves in the local music scene!

Guba: Sabahan singer-songwriter that is filled with great folk-pop tunes. Check out his collaboration with Yuna on the song “You’re So Fine” here. Although typically an acoustic act, he’ll be performing with a full band at the festival.

Francis Wolf: Folk singer-songwriter whose songs tells many stories behind melodies. Check out his set on The Wknd here.

Froya: Quirky electrocoustic pop singer with captivating music reminiscent of Sia and the likes. Check out her songs here.

Pastel Lite: Eff Hakin and Mohd Faliq make experimental music that’s still really accessible. Check out their SoundCloud here.

Darren Ashley: Darren Ashley’s wonderfully crafted pop tunes is fun for the ears and Darren himself is super-energetic onstage. Peep his eclectic SoundCloud here.

OJ Law: One of the brightest new acts in the scene, mixing rock, pop, electronics and folk with ease. You have to be something special to have a Last Polka ice-cream named after you.

Enterprise: Subang boys whose music is just effortlessly cool. Atmospheric and dancey rock that you can get your freak on to. Get a taste of their music here.

Love/Comes: Gracing our stages by way of Kuching, Love/Comes delivers catchy, shoegazey tunes that push all the right buttons. Listen here.

Ernest Zacharevic: Lithuanian artist who is currently based in Penang. Check out his Facebook page on the link above for a look at his unique work. For Urbanscapes, let’s just say his installation will be larger than life.

Shelah!: Malaysia’s most-loved queen! She’ll have you in stitches for her Urbanscapes show, and then some.

Poetry Cafe KL: Does the spoken word…speak to you? Then you must be part of Poetry Cafe’s poetry slam at Urbanscapes.

Kontak! X themancalleduncle: They’ll be working together on an audio-visual collaboration to perk up the fest when night falls, and will also be enhancing Poetry Cafe KL’s set with some AV magic.

Monsoon+ x senseless art: Monsoon+ will team up with photographer Cipoi from Senseless Art for a multimedia exhibition on Malaysia’s music scene.

Karya: The collective of multi-disciplinary artists will work on making art stand out at one of our satellite stages.
